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Denver Broncos say John Elway will provide boost 'right away'
#1
[Image: http://api.tweetmeme.com/imagebutton.gif...NHeadlines]The Denver Broncos and John Elway have reached an agreement for him to join the team's front office this week as an executive vice president, team sources have told ESPN NFL Insider Adam Schefter.

More...

Forum Jump:

Users browsing this thread: 1 Guest(s)